Myagdi
The Water Induced Disaster Management Sub Division Office in Baglung has said that it plans to build walls along the banks of Kaligandaki and Myagdi rivers to mitigate the risk of flood in Beni Bazaar.
The project is expected to cost Rs 12 million and the office has already signed an agreement with the Pokhara-based BG Constructions, said officials said.
